Data Scientist

AppleSeattle, WA
$137,500 - $207,100Onsite

About The Position

Perform statistical analysis of retail online data with the purpose of optimization (A/B testing) and forecasting. Build, test, implement and analyze multivariate testing programs for the Apple Online Store. Quantify and analyze testing outcomes and provide analytical readouts on test results using various statistical techniques. Work with large and complex data sets and partner with Data Engineering teams to ensure accurate collection of data values into the analytical clickstream. Design and execute observational and experimental studies of causal inference to drive feature evaluation and product roadmap with data science based insights. Develop scalable data models and solutions to be used to drive analyses, reports, anomaly detections, alerts and insights. Influence upstream data model design, drive KPI definitions and develop customized data solutions. Measure impact of features and initiatives and help improve customer experience. Apply machine learning concepts such as regression, Natural Language Processing, Decision Trees, and Gradient Boosting, to develop holistic view of customer behavior and features to identify areas of opportunity for experimentation, feature improvements and algorithm optimizations. Collaborate and influence cross functional partners to help deliver product objectives on time. Communicate results, insights and expectations to partners and senior leaders. Work independently in sophisticated and highly visible projects, identify risks and develop frameworks, regularly connect with collaborators and leadership teams to propose features, develop and implement experiments for investigating and answering business questions.

Requirements

  • Master’s degree or foreign equivalent in Data Science, Statistics, Applied Mathematics, Physics, Machine Learning, Computer Science, Engineering or related field and 2 years of experience in the job offered or related occupation.
  • Utilize SQL, Spark, Hadoop and data mining techniques to extract and develop data models.
  • Utilize Python, R, or Scala to process and develop statistical and machine learning models.
  • Utilize Design of Experiments, Bayesian modeling and Statistical theory to develop and measure experiments and A/B tests.
  • Utilize Machine Learning, Classification, Clustering, Forecasting and feature importance modeling to measure feature and product performance.
  • Utilize Causal inferencing and Data Science to run observational studies.
  • Utilize data interpretation and statistical acumen skills to infer insights from noisy and complex data sets and make recommendations.
  • Leverage data visualization tools to monitor, alert and provide real-time analysis of features.
  • Communicating statistical and technical output to non-technical business partners.
